ANCIENT GREEK BRONZE COINS, a group of smaller bronze coins from Ionia, Smyrna, AE 10, rev.lyre, (cf.BMC 71-8); another AE 15, (2nd century A.D.), obv. Amazon Smyrna head to left, rev. prow, (SNG Cop.1266); Ionia, Colophon, (390-350 B.C.), obv. Apollo, rev. kithera, (S.4351, SNG Von Aulock 2008), another (285-190 B.C.), rev. horse to right, Ionia, Miletus, (350-300 B.C.), AE 17, rev. lion right looking back, (S.4515); Kingdom of Thrace, Lysimachus, (323-281 B.C.), AE 20, rev. lion leaping right, (S.6819); others (2) probably from Asia Minor, attributable. Fine - very fine. (8)
